Did John and Paul ever reconcile?

They began to reconcile during Lennon’s ‘Lost Weekend’ period. From the summer of 1973 to early 1975, Lennon disappeared into a creative and outrageous period of his life dubbed his Lost Weekend — which included an accidental reconciliation with McCartney.

What was the last song Paul McCartney and John Lennon wrote together?

The final track that saw them share credit equally is suggested by Beatles Bible to be 1967’s ‘Baby You’re A Rich Man’. It’s a combination of two unfinished Lennon-McCartney songs, it was recorded in a single day and issued as the B-side to ‘All You Need Is Love’.

Did John Lennon and Paul McCartney ever play together?

A Toot and a Snore in ’74 is a bootleg album of the only known recording session in which John Lennon and Paul McCartney played together after the break-up of the Beatles. First mentioned by Lennon in a 1975 interview, more details were brought to light in May Pang ‘s 1983 book, Loving John,…

What instruments did John Lennon and Paul McCartney play with Nilsson?

Lennon is on lead vocal and guitar, and McCartney sings harmony and plays Ringo Starr ‘s drums. (Starr, who was recording with Nilsson at the time but not present at the session, complained at the next day’s recording session that ” [McCartney] always messes up my drums!”)
